An Australian film that doesn't spend its running time trying to be "Australian", in fact, nothing about this film suggests it is an Australian film.
This Sci-Fi head scratcher is the sort of time travel movie I enjoy, one that makes you think, and explores the complexity of time travel.
The plot is completely insane. You'll spend the first half in a complete fog of confusion as you try to figure out what the hell is going on, only to start to realise what it all means, and end up still scratching your head at the eventual answer (which is unusual to say the least).
Imported Ethan Hawke and local Sarah Snook are both great in their roles. The low budget is not a problem, as the film doesn't reply on special effects, and has one of the simplest but brilliant time machines you'll ever see.
